

Prior to the Brooklyn Nets' Sunday afternoon meeting against Donovan Mitchell and the Cleveland Cavaliers, several key pieces have already been named on the injured list.
According to Nets Daily's Collin Helwig, the Nets released updates on the availability of three crucial components of their lineup.
After being diagnosed with a thumb sprain, Nic Claxton may be sidelined for the battle against Cleveland's devastating frontcourt duo of Evan Mobley and Jarrett Allen. Claxton enjoyed a phenomenal 5-game stretch prior to the questionable tag, averaging 16.6 points, 6.6 rebounds, 4.6 assists and 1.0 steals in that span.
Dëmin has been definitively ruled out with left plantar fascia, and fellow first-round pick rookie Drake Powell will remain with the Nets' G-League affiliate Long Island squad after being assigned Friday.
